Ok. Possibilities are limited.
#1 - You added less salt than you thought, because they weren't 40# bags OR were diluted with something.
#2 - Your 'guess strips' were off . . . and so were the pool stores' strips.
#3 - Your pool has more gallons than you thought.
#4 - You're leaking and replacing a LOT of water.
I can't think of any others. If you add 160# of salt to 10,000 gallons of water, you are going to increase salinity by nearly 2000 ppm, every day of the year, everywhere in the world.
